That expense ratio is on the low side of average for what the fund is. Actively managed small cap value isn't a particularly cheap market sector. There are cheaper alternatives but they aren't going to come with the depth of research that Avantis offers (which is what you're really paying for). Or simply use an app or excel for that. Find ER of each fund, put that value in and multiply it by respective weight. Eg: Fund A has 0.03 ER and is 50% of your portfolio, fund B has 0.07 ER and is 50% of your portfolio. (Coincidentally the case for 50% VTI 50% VXUS I think) 0.03 x 0.5 = 0.015.
